911 GT3 R Rennsport

Performance in numbers

Engine

Water-cooled six-cylinder boxer motor in rear position

Displacement

4,194 cm³

Performance

456 kW (620 hp) at 9,400 rpm

Gears

Porsche six-speed sequential dog-type transmission

Weight

1,240 kg

Drive line

Rear-wheel drive

Price: 951.000 €, plus VAT and options, ex works, 1.046.000 USD, plus VAT and options, ex works

* The vehicle is not street legal, it is not homologated and does not comply with any current race series regulations.
